牛津词典
noun
- 摩门教徒(摩门教正式名称为“耶稣基督末世圣徒教会”,1830年由约瑟夫∙史密斯于美国创建)
a member of a religion formed by Joseph Smith in the US in 1830, officially called ‘the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ints’- a Mormon church/chapel
摩门教教会 / 教堂
- a Mormon church/chapel
